.tns-outer{padding:0 !important}.tns-outer [hidden]{display:none !important}.tns-outer [aria-controls],.tns-outer [data-action]{cursor:pointer}.tns-slider{-webkit-transition:all 0s;-moz-transition:all 0s;transition:all 0s}.tns-slider>.tns-item{-webkit-box-sizing:border-box;-moz-box-sizing:border-box;box-sizing:border-box}.tns-horizontal.tns-subpixel{white-space:nowrap}.tns-horizontal.tns-subpixel>.tns-item{display:inline-block;vertical-align:top;white-space:normal}.tns-horizontal.tns-no-subpixel:after{content:'';display:table;clear:both}.tns-horizontal.tns-no-subpixel>.tns-item{float:left}.tns-horizontal.tns-carousel.tns-no-subpixel>.tns-item{margin-right:-100%}.tns-no-calc{position:relative;left:0}.tns-gallery{position:relative;left:0;min-height:1px}.tns-gallery>.tns-item{position:absolute;left:-100%;-webkit-transition:transform 0s, opacity 0s;-moz-transition:transform 0s, opacity 0s;transition:transform 0s, opacity 0s}.tns-gallery>.tns-slide-active{position:relative;left:auto !important}.tns-gallery>.tns-moving{-webkit-transition:all 0.25s;-moz-transition:all 0.25s;transition:all 0.25s}.tns-autowidth{display:inline-block}.tns-lazy-img{-webkit-transition:opacity 0.6s;-moz-transition:opacity 0.6s;transition:opacity 0.6s;opacity:0.6}.tns-lazy-img.tns-complete{opacity:1}.tns-ah{-webkit-transition:height 0s;-moz-transition:height 0s;transition:height 0s}.tns-ovh{overflow:hidden}.tns-visually-hidden{position:absolute;left:-10000em}.tns-transparent{opacity:0;visibility:hidden}.tns-fadeIn{opacity:1;filter:alpha(opacity=100);z-index:0}.tns-normal,.tns-fadeOut{opacity:0;filter:alpha(opacity=0);z-index:-1}.tns-vpfix{white-space:nowrap}.tns-vpfix>div,.tns-vpfix>li{display:inline-block}.tns-t-subp2{margin:0 auto;width:310px;position:relative;height:10px;overflow:hidden}.tns-t-ct{width:2333.3333333%;width:-webkit-calc(100% * 70 / 3);width:-moz-calc(100% * 70 / 3);width:calc(100% * 70 / 3);position:absolute;right:0}.tns-t-ct:after{content:'';display:table;clear:both}.tns-t-ct>div{width:1.4285714%;width:-webkit-calc(100% / 70);width:-moz-calc(100% / 70);width:calc(100% / 70);height:10px;float:left}
/*# sourceMappingURL=sourcemaps/tiny-slider.css.map */

/* Customized controls */
.tns-nav{
  display: none;
}
.carousel{
  position: relative;
  opacity: 0;
}
.carousel-nav li {
  display: block;
  position: absolute;
  top: 160px;
  margin-top: -60px;
  width: 120px;
  height: 120px;
  cursor: pointer;
}
.carousel-nav li:after{
  z-index: 0;
  position: absolute;
  top: 50%;
  left: 50%;
  transform: translate(-50%,-50%);
  -webkit-transform: translate(-50%,-50%);
  content:'';
  display:block;
    background: transparent;
    border-radius: 50%;
    width: 80px;
    height: 80px;
    -webkit-transition:0.3s all ease-out, 0.3s width cubic-bezier(0.175, 0.885, 0.32, 1.275), 0.3s height cubic-bezier(0.175, 0.885, 0.32, 1.275);
    -moz-transition:0.3s all ease-out, 0.3s width cubic-bezier(0.175, 0.885, 0.32, 1.275), 0.3s height cubic-bezier(0.175, 0.885, 0.32, 1.275);
    transition:0.3s all ease-out, 0.3s width cubic-bezier(0.175, 0.885, 0.32, 1.275), 0.3s height cubic-bezier(0.175, 0.885, 0.32, 1.275);
}
.carousel-nav li path{
  -webkit-transition:0.3s all ease-out;
  -moz-transition:0.3s all ease-out;
  transition:0.3s all ease-out;
}
.carousel-nav li svg{
  position: absolute;
  z-index:1;
  top:50%;
  margin-top:-15px;
}
.carousel-nav .prev {left: 60px;}
.carousel-nav .prev svg{margin-left: 50px;}
.carousel-nav .next {right: 60px;}
.carousel-nav .next svg{margin-left:-10px;}
.carousel-nav li:hover:after{
  background: #CA5B3F;
  width: 120px;
    height: 120px;
}
.carousel-nav li:hover path:last-child{opacity:0;}